 Instant coffee turning hard or losing its fragrance is a very common kitchen problem. With a few simple storage hacks, you can keep your coffee dry and flavourful for a longer period of time.

Step 1

Always use a thoroughly dry spoon to scoop out coffee every time. Even a tiny moisture drop can make it clump and spoil the texture fast.

Step 2

Transfer the coffee from its original jar to an airtight jar. Tight seals will protect it from humidity, exposure to air, and loss of flavour.

Step 3

Store instant coffee in a cool, dry place and not near the stove or sink. Heat and steam are the biggest enemies that destroy the freshness of coffee.

Step 4

Avoid keeping the instant coffee in the fridge. Temperature changes can cause condensation, due to which the coffee hardens and tastes dull.

Step 5

Add a few uncooked rice grains inside the container and a silica gel packet outside to absorb the excess moisture.

Step 6

Close the lid immediately after each use. Leaving the jar open, even for a short time span, lets humid air enter and affects the texture over time.
